What Is Bone Density?



Bone density describes the amount of mineral content in your bones, specifically calcium and phosphorus, which establishes their stamina and framework. Healthy bone thickness is essential for total bone health, as it aids avoid cracks and sustains your body's various functions. When your bone thickness is optimal, your bones can endure everyday tensions and stress without breaking.

As you age, your bone thickness normally decreases, especially in women post-menopause. This decrease can result in problems like osteoporosis, making bones extra breakable and vulnerable to injury.

To maintain or boost your bone density, you have actually reached take notice of your lifestyle choices. Regular weight-bearing workouts, a balanced diet regimen abundant in calcium and vitamin D, and staying clear of smoking cigarettes and excessive alcohol intake can all add substantially.

Obtaining routine bone thickness testings can also assist you track modifications over time. If you observe a decline, your doctor can advise interventions, such as nutritional changes or medicines, to aid maintain your bone wellness.

Influence On Dental Implants



Ample bone thickness is essential for the success of dental implants. When you undertake an implant treatment, the implant requirements to integrate with your jawbone, offering security and toughness. If your bone thickness is insufficient, the dental implant might not fuse correctly, causing issues like implant failing. You want a tough structure for your implant, and low bone thickness can compromise that.

Insufficient bone density can likewise influence the positioning of the dental implant. If the bone isn't thick enough to sustain the dental implant, your dental expert might've to position it in a much less optimal placement, which can bring about imbalance and pain. This can affect your ability to chew and talk effectively.

Furthermore, low bone density can boost the threat of infection around the implant site. Without solid bone support, the body may battle to heal correctly, and that can result in issues better down the line.



Inevitably, guaranteeing you have sufficient bone thickness not only increases the instant success of your dental implant yet additionally boosts your long-term dental health and wellness and performance. So, prior to waging implants, it's crucial to assess your bone density and discuss any worry about your dental practitioner.

Solutions for Low Bone Density



If you're encountering low bone density and considering dental implants, there are numerous reliable options to check out.

Initially, your dentist may recommend bone grafting, where they make use of bone product from one more part of your body or a benefactor to restore the bone framework in your jaw. This procedure can produce a more powerful foundation for your implants.

Another choice is using oral implants particularly made for reduced bone thickness. Mini oral implants are smaller in diameter and call for much less bone, making them a good selection if your bone density is endangered.

You can additionally check into the possibility of using development variables or bone-stimulating medicines. These therapies can urge your body to regenerate bone tissue and improve thickness in time.

Last but not least, way of living adjustments-- like enhanced calcium and vitamin D intake, normal workout, and stopping smoking cigarettes-- can likewise strengthen your bones.

Before making any type of decisions, consult your dentist or dental surgeon to go over the best services customized to your circumstance. Together, you can determine the very best course forward for an effective dental implant treatment.
